Another cool thing that happens here is that people get to go cross country skiing and that is happening today as well.  Our trusty Pisten Bully, even while running on reduced power was able to make at least a single skate/classic pass on almost every trail today with double passes on the fields, Woolsey Woods, Moose Loop, and Homesite.  Even better news is that if all goes according to plan, by sundown Monday it will be back to its full “rip –snortin” 115 horse power which will be a really good thing.

Conditions as of 1:30 were a mix of light snow showers with the sun trying to peak through from time to time.  About 6 inches of snow has fallen in the past 24 hours and the current temperature is -3ºC/26ºF.

Snow is forecast to continue to fall throughout the week and things will be really busy with all the teams, Wilson Wintersports, and the IMD Qualifier on Friday and Saturday but there still should be many opportunities for everybody to ski.  Look for a tentative grooming schedule in tomorrow’s report.

Groomer’s choice for today is Homesite which is at its best for the year.
